Narrative:The ultralight pilot instructor flew according to VFR rules around the country. Regarding the fuel condition, he relied on splashing in the tank. Due to changes in the angle of incidence, it suddenly showed him that he was out of fuel. The plane declared MAYDAY and glided to LJLJ airport. No one was hurt. The reason for the event is a lack of planning (taxi fuel, trip fuel, final fuel reserve, alternate fuel, additional fuel, etc.).
